It’s been 5 years since we three
, my son, hubby and i went for a vacation.
The last time we travelled was to Delhi and Ranthambore wildlife sanctuary in 2010. Our son was was growing up so we had decided to travel every year.
But destiny had some other plans for me.
I was diagnosed with Multiple Myeloma in Oct 2011,  been going through all the ups and downs all the while. Finally I now have the courage to travel . I had promised my son that we will go once he joins college.
After checking out various locations we zeroed in on Dubai. We began planning for the trip. We started exploring various options. We didnt want to go through the regular travels agencies like Thomas cook or cox and kings etc. We then decided on the dates, the Airlines that we want to travel with , the various hotels that are available, the local tourist spots etc.
I expressed my desire to travel , to my Oncologist, my Ayurvedic doctor and my Physician.
All of them said I can go and wished me well. When I asked my Physician to suggest any medication for problems like stomach upset etc, she immediately pulled out a sheet and quickly wrote down medications for cold, cough, fever, stomach pain, gas in the stomach, pain killers, diarrhoea etc.
Said I need not worry as the trip is just for a few days.
We booked tickets and hotel accommodation and also applied for online Visa from the Emirates website as we booked tickets on Emirates.
We just received our visas by mail.
Our trip is from 16 Feb to 21 Feb.

I have been planning about the foods that I would be eating while I am travelling.  Having just recovered from severe stomach upset and asthma , I am lil worried about having food outside. 
I have made a list of snacks that I would carry from here.
I checked if there is a supermarket or grocery near the hotel that we booked and thankfully there is one in the adjacent lane.
I plan to raid this supermarket as soon as we land there and pickup a lot of fresh fruits and some veggies like carrots , cucumbers etc.

Hope to travel safe and get back home intact.
